Author: tchemit Date: 2010-06-13 19:30:39 +0200 (Sun, 13 Jun 2010) New Revision: 2008 Url: http://nuiton.org/repositories/revision/topia/2008 Log: isSchemaExist can be used for any type of persistent classes (not only for TopiaEntity) Modified: trunk/topia-persistence/src/main/java/org/nuiton/topia/framework/TopiaContextImpl.java trunk/topia-persistence/src/main/java/org/nuiton/topia/framework/TopiaContextImplementor.java Modified: trunk/topia-persistence/src/main/java/org/nuiton/topia/framework/TopiaContextImpl.java =================================================================== --- trunk/topia-persistence/src/main/java/org/nuiton/topia/framework/TopiaContextImpl.java 2010-06-13 09:43:00 UTC (rev 2007) +++ trunk/topia-persistence/src/main/java/org/nuiton/topia/framework/TopiaContextImpl.java 2010-06-13 17:30:39 UTC (rev 2008) @@ -1334,7 +1334,7 @@ } @Override - public boolean isSchemaExist(Class<? extends TopiaEntity> clazz) + public boolean isSchemaExist(Class<?> clazz) throws TopiaException { checkClosed(I18n._( "topia.persistence.error.unsupported.operation.on.closed.context", Modified: trunk/topia-persistence/src/main/java/org/nuiton/topia/framework/TopiaContextImplementor.java =================================================================== --- trunk/topia-persistence/src/main/java/org/nuiton/topia/framework/TopiaContextImplementor.java 2010-06-13 09:43:00 UTC (rev 2007) +++ trunk/topia-persistence/src/main/java/org/nuiton/topia/framework/TopiaContextImplementor.java 2010-06-13 17:30:39 UTC (rev 2008) @@ -100,7 +100,7 @@ * @return Returns the hibernate. * @throws TopiaException si aucune transaction n'est ouverte */ - boolean isSchemaExist(Class<? extends TopiaEntity> clazz) throws TopiaException; + boolean isSchemaExist(Class<?> clazz) throws TopiaException; /** * Get DAO for specified class. If Specialized DAO exists then it returned